The symbol used in division is called the division sign, which is represented by the obelus (÷). In addition to the obelus, division can also be expressed using the forward slash (/) or the horizontal line (also known as a fraction bar) in mathematical notation.
The division sign helps to indicate that one number is being divided by another. For example, in the expression 8 ÷ 2, the number 8 is the dividend, and 2 is the divisor. The result of this division is called the quotient, which in this case is 4.
In summary, the most common division symbol is the obelus (÷), but you may also encounter division represented by the slash (/) or as a fraction in different contexts.
